Taijuan Walker has a strike rate of just 58% (404/699) in two strike counts this season — lowest among qualified SPs in MLB; League Avg: 64% — first Percentile.

Opponents have a miss rate of just 17% (30/179) against Taijuan Walker on the first pitch of at-bats this season — lowest among qualified SPs in MLB; League Avg: 27% — second Percentile.

Opponents have a miss rate of just 21% (230/1,097) against Taijuan Walker this season — tied for 4th lowest among qualified SPs in MLB; League Avg: 26% — ninth Percentile.

Right-handed hitters have a swing rate of just 44% (564/1,284) against Taijuan Walker this season — 3rd lowest among qualified SPs in MLB; League Avg: 49% — sixth Percentile.

Cardinals Starting Pitcher Stats & Trends

Left-handed hitters have a chase rate of just 20% (170/851) against Dakota Hudson since last season — lowest in MLB among starting pitchers with at least 123 total IP; League Avg: 28% — first Percentile.

Jose Quintana had a strike rate of just 62% (1,438/2,302) against right-handed batters in 2022 — tied for lowest among qualified SPs in MLB; League Avg: 66% — fourth Percentile.

Dakota Hudson has a strikeout rate of just 13% (115 SO in 881 PAs) since last season — lowest in MLB among starting pitchers with at least 123 total IP; League Avg: 22% — 0 Percentile.
